Output 594fa637f39f61458e5ca82a976b2b4e9653c117daaede03bbbeff2d38da9bf6:0

value
695697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30052660f2d85b1aa95386c98b782deb363bf134 OP_EQUAL
address
364vXaFYvrguJ5WyxSZaMd7ZDR6UKFo7FM
transaction
594fa637f39f61458e5ca82a976b2b4e9653c117daaede03bbbeff2d38da9bf6
confirmations
20980
spent
true